First, cutting off rhubarb flowers prevents the plant from putting its energy into flower production, which can be a drain on the plant’s resources. Remove these flower stalks by cutting them with a sharp, clean knife as close to the base of the plant as possible. First things first, as soon as you see those flower stalks, grab your shears and cut them off at the base. By removing the flowers, the plant can focus. Fully cut back the spent foliage and stems to the base of the plant. Rhubarb flowers can simply be cut from the plant as soon as you see them appear. Pruning rhubarb is fairly simple if you follow a simple process for cutting back the plant: Remove any of the flowering stems to prevent your rhubarb from going to seed. The stems can still be used in cooking (though the leaves are still poisonous). If your rhubarb produces a flower, this does not affect the stems and leaves.
